Output fda258b2cb7c33897a3cacedc8526153dd4ba890b2df639acfa0a71655fcfec8:0

value
143494065
script pubkey
OP_0 OP_PUSHBYTES_20 9515ac5611c7f2966ca410ddb07a2e7ddf9a0a29
address
bc1qj526c4s3clefvm9yzrwmq73w0h0e5z3fzw49cj
transaction
fda258b2cb7c33897a3cacedc8526153dd4ba890b2df639acfa0a71655fcfec8
confirmations
139660
spent
true